| Albert's Table Awarded 2 RosettesLocal Restaurant Becomes The First In Croydon To Be Awarded AA Rosettes
By: Kennedy PR The award is a great milestone, personally and professionally for head chef and owner Joby Wells. "It is a great honor to receive Rosettes. It is a sign that we are producing a very high standard of food and we are absolutely thrilled. I just want to thank all of our staff for their hard work, and our fantastic customers for their unwavering support these last few years." Joby opened Albert's Table in 2008 after working in the some of London's most prestigious restaurants. He wanted to create food in a simpler and more honest way that was more about the ingredients being used than the techniques used on them. In 2011 Jay Rayner reviewed Albert's Table for the Guardian saying that it was "a solid, sturdy restaurant knocking out solid, sturdy dishes full of flavours that loiter after you've finished" In 2012 Albert's Table received a mention in the Michelin Guide and was also listed in the Hardens Good Food Guide. Joby and his team have been quietly plugging away since then, providing an experience that is very different from other restaurants in the area. Sourcing ingredients from suppliers nationwide that highlight the quality of British farms. Last year Joby worked with production company Etio to create a documentary on British produce, excerpts from this can be seen on the Albert's Table website.
